The latest announcement is out from Dolby Laboratories ( (DLB) ).
On January 29, 2026, Dolby Laboratories reported first-quarter fiscal 2026 revenue of $347 million, down from $357 million a year earlier, with GAAP net income slipping to $53 million, or $0.55 per diluted share, and non-GAAP earnings of $1.06 per share versus $1.14 in the prior-year quarter. The company underscored continued adoption of Dolby Atmos and Dolby Vision across automotive and streaming, highlighting uptake by more than 35 auto OEMs, new integrations with Mercedes-Benz, Mahindra and Qualcomm’s Gen 5 Snapdragon Automotive platform, as well as broader use of Dolby Vision and Atmos by Peacock, major TV brands including Hisense, TCL and TP Vision, LG’s new Dolby Atmos FlexConnect-based sound system, and Meta’s support for Dolby Vision on Facebook and Instagram. Dolby returned capital to shareholders by repurchasing about one million shares for roughly $70 million and declared a $0.36 per-share dividend payable on February 18, 2026 to stockholders of record on February 10, 2026, while issuing guidance for fiscal 2026 that envisions total revenue between $1.4 billion and $1.45 billion, very high gross margins near 90% and non-GAAP operating margins in the mid-30% range, despite acknowledging macroeconomic and geopolitical uncertainties that could weigh on royalty-based licensing revenue.

More about Dolby Laboratories
Dolby Laboratories is a San Francisco-based audio and imaging technology company whose core business centers on licensing its Dolby Atmos immersive audio and Dolby Vision high dynamic range video formats, along with related technologies such as imaging patent programs and Dolby OptiView, to consumer electronics makers, automakers, content streamers, and media platforms worldwide.
